問題タブ [mobiscroll]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
jquery - Android での入力タイプの日付の検証
jQuery Mobile 1.3.1 を使用しており、日付ピッカーを含むフォームが必要です。私はドキュメントを調べて、これを思いつきました:
これは iOS で機能しますが、日付をローカル形式から に変換します2013-04-30
。
Android では、ネイティブの日付ピッカーが出力するため、フォームが送信されないことがわかりました2013-4-30
。送信時に日付ピッカーがポップアップし、値を選択する必要があると表示されます。しかし、値を に変更することはできません2013-04-30
。
これはどのように正しく行われますか?jQuery Mobile の datpicker は、すべてのブラウザーとデバイスで動作しますか?
解決:
Mobiscrollを使用しました:
javascript - mobiScroll - 追加ボタンをクリックしたときにホイールの値をリセットする
mobiscroll スクローラーに thrid 機能を追加しようとしています。まず、いくつかの説明: 「0」から「9」までの 4 つのカスタム作成ホイールがあります。ユーザーはここに 4 桁の数字を挿入できます。
標準の「キャンセル」(「Abbrechen」) と「追加」(「OK」) ボタンに加えて、スクローラー内のすべてのホイールを値「0」に設定するリセット (「Bestand」) ボタンを実装したいと考えています。この追加ボタンを追加することは問題ありませんでしたが、残念ながら、必要な機能を追加することは困難です. 必要な関数は、4 つのホイールすべての値を値「0」にリセットするだけです。これまでの私のコードに従ってください:
ホイールを初期化します....
スクローラーを初期化します....(ループ内で).......
機能性を実現するために多くの方法を試しましたが、何もうまくいきませんでした....この問題を解決するにはどうすればよいですか?この問題の修正にすでに多くの時間を費やしていたので (丸 2 日...)、すべての回答やヒントをいただければ幸いです。
mobiscroll - 条件に基づいて Mobiscroll の日付と時刻のスクローラーで日付ホイールの色を変更する
私の組織では、毎日 4 つのシフト (A ~ D) のうちの 1 つが働いており、シフトは色 (赤、青、緑、黄色) に関連付けられています。
ASP.NET MVC アプリのデスクトップ ビューで jQuery UI の datepicker を使用し、beforeShowDay オプションを使用してカレンダーの日の背景色を変更し、ユーザーが毎日どのシフトが働いているかを一目で確認できるようにします。
その日に働いていたシフトに基づいてデイホイールの背景の色が変わるように、Mobiscroll で同じことを行うことは可能ですか?
または、それが不可能な場合は、曜日ラベルを変更してシフト (A - D) の名前を含めても問題ありません。
mobiscroll インスタンスに onChange を追加してみました:
onChange イベントは発生しますが、mobiscroll ウィジェットはすぐに閉じます。再度開くと、dayText ラベルが正しく変更されています。ウィジェットを開いたままラベルを変更する方法がわかりません。
jquery - mobiscroll オプションのテキストを変更する
次のコードを使用すると、標準オプションのテキストを変更できます。
このコードは、mobiscroll を使用しているオプションでは機能しません。どうすればこれを機能させることができますか?
jquery - jtsage datebox がヘッダーを固定からインラインに変更します
jtsage databox を使用しようとすると、奇妙な問題が発生します。私のjquerymobileページのヘッダーとフッターは「固定」されているはずです。ユーザーがデータ ピッカーを開くまで、これらのヘッダーとフッターは固定されたままです。しかし、日付ピッカーを使用すると、ヘッダーとフッターは「固定」されなくなります。なぜだめですか?(そして、ユーザーがタッチしたときに datepicker が行う他の奇妙なことは何ですか?)ここに例を示します。
jquery - Jquery Mobile: jquery select (mobiscroll) 内の無効なオプションを再度有効にすることはできません
jquery select内の無効なオプションをすべて無効にしようとしています.....特定のオプションを無効にするとうまくいきますが、それらを再度有効にしたいときは、それらはまだ無効のままです....この問題を解決するために多くのことが必要ですが、私の試みはうまくいきません....
いくつかのより詳細な説明に続きます。どんな助けにもとても感謝しています!
すべてのオプションを指定した jquery select:
特定のボタンをクリックすると、これらの値が mobiscroll select-scroller 内に表示されます。
ユーザーが 1 つのタスクを選択した後 (たとえば、Arbeitsbegin [英語: 仕事の開始])、このオプションを無効にしたいと考えています。これはうまくいきます。しかし、もう一度有効にしたい場合、これは機能しません。click-handler、mobiscroll-scroller、および change 関数 (これは機能しません....) のコードに従います。
クリックハンドラー:
Mobiscroll-Scroller:
動作しない変更関数 (この関数は、mobiscroll-scroller の onSelect-callback 関数によって呼び出されます)
enyone がこの問題で私を助けることができれば、それは素晴らしいことです.... ありがとう、ダニエル
jquery - Mobiscroll は更新時にすべての入力ボックスを無効にします
Web ページで mobiscroll 2.1 を使用しています。私が直面している問題は、入力ボタンをクリックして Mobiscroll と Mobiscroll ウィジェットがポップアップ表示されるのを確認すると、[設定] または [キャンセル] ボタンをクリックする代わりに、F5 を押すかページを更新すると、すべての入力フィールドが無効になることです。問題は Firefox のみです)。
前もって感謝します !!
javascript - How to get the value of scroller item on Mobiscroll tap event
フープを介してジャンプして、タップ イベントで選択されたアイテムを取得します。スクローラーで選択したアイテムの値を取得するために私がしたことは次のとおりです。
ここにhtmlがあります。
多分これを行うためのより良い方法がありますか?
mobiscroll - Mobiscrollカレンダーのマークされた日付を更新する
Mobiscroll カレンダー ( http://mobiscroll.com/ ) では、Mobiscroll カレンダーの初期化時にマーク日を設定できます。カレンダーが初期化された後にマーク日を更新する方法はありますか? ドキュメントでそうする方法が見つからないようです。